TPL Version 1.27

Thermal Power Library 1.27 is part of Modelon's 2024.1 release. New versions of Modelon libraries are sold and distributed directly from Modelon, as well as approved resellers.

Version 1.27 contains the changes described below.

Build 1 (2024-02-14)

Fixed issue

  • Fixed a bug in direct air capturing (DAC) cyclic controller and made it more transparent to ease understanding.
  • Fixed a bug in the  Deaerator Model , updated the equation for drain pressure calculation.
  • Removed top level geometry parameters in BedInterface and instead now will be using values from geometry record instantiated as BedGeo in BedInterface.

Improvements

  • Support of ambient temperatures below 0 °C by defaulting reference state in ThermalPower.System_TPL to positive temperatures.
  • Added base record for adsorption in BedBase, which is extended for any bed geometry.
  • Consolidated adsorption column and adsorption heat exchanger into AdsorptionHX.

  • Added comprehensive summary to DeNOx component in DeNox subpackage
  • Added the top-level parameters of n_channels_prim and n_channels_sec in ThermalPower.SeparationProcess.HeatExchangers.StaticNTU to describe the numbers of parallel channels in primary side and secondary side. Note, this model is deprecated, prefer ThermalPower.SeparationProcess.HeatExchangers.EpsNTU as it is a more slim model with the same functionality.
  • Changed medium model for district heating in HeatPump example for higher accuracy.
  • Changed the location of ConstantPropertyWater from ThermalPower.Media.Liquid to Modelon.Media.PreDefined.Liquids.
  • Moved the packages "MicroGrid" and "DIstrictHeating" to the Deprecated package as the respective content is now featured in a much more userfiendly and robust manner in Modelon's Energy System library

New features

  • Addition of Test Bench model for the Benson Separator.
  • Addition of  Quality , Subcooling and Superheat sensors.
  • Added a new Tube and shell Heat Exchanger with 2 phase mediums on both primary and secondary  side .
  • New geometry record for Brick type adsorption bed in BrickGeometry.
  • New type of adsorption bed can be found under MovingBed including its disc sector geometry record and a system example RotatingAdsorptionCO2FromAir which employs this.
  • New table-based linear driving force model with default values from Silica gel material.
